然后,使用pandas的read_csv函数读取CSV文件: python import pandas as pd # 读取CSV文件 df = pd.read_csv('your_file.csv') # 替换'your_file.csv'为您的CSV文件名 2. 指定要读取的行号范围 在pandas中,通常不直接“读取”特定的行号范围,而是先读取整个数据框(DataFrame),然后通过索引来选择行。但是,如...
接下来,我们将分别使用这两个库来显示如何读取 CSV 文件的某一列。 2.1 使用csv库 csv是 Python 自带的库,使用非常简单。以下是通过csv库读取Score列的示例代码: importcsv filename='students.csv'withopen(filename,mode='r',newline='')asfile:reader=csv.DictReader(file)scores=[row['Score']forrowinr...
方便,有专门支持读取csv文件的pd.read_csv()函数。 将csv转换成二维列表形式 支持通过列名查找特定列。 相比csv库,事半功倍。 开始pandas操作csv文件之旅: 0.csv文件预览 1.读取csv文件 import pandas as pd file="E:\data\test.csv" csvPD=pd.read_csv(file) 1. 2. 3. 4. 2.查找指定列及指定单元...
importpandasaspd# 读取CSV文件df = pd.read_csv('data.csv')# 打印整个DataFrame以供参考print("整个DataFrame:")print(df)# 循环遍历'name'列的所有行数据forindex, rowindf.iterrows():# row是一个Series对象,代表当前行的数据# 可以通过列名访问特定列的值name = row['name']print(f"行号:{index}, 姓...
在Python语言中,使用Pandas的read_csv函数可以读取csv文件。如果想在某一行有特定的刺痛之后读取csv,可以通过以下步骤实现: 导入Pandas库: 代码语言:txt 复制 import pandas as pd 使用read_csv函数读取csv文件: 代码语言:txt 复制 df = pd.read_csv('file.csv') ...
要从CSV文件中仅读取特定的行和单元格,可以按照以下步骤进行操作: 导入pandas库: 代码语言:txt 复制 import pandas as pd 使用read_csv()函数读取CSV文件,并将其存储为一个DataFrame对象: 代码语言:txt 复制 df = pd.read_csv('file.csv') 读取特定的行,可以使用iloc属性和行索引号。例如,...
read_csv()函数的不同参数选项的应用场景 指定分隔符 有时候,CSV文件可能使用除逗号以外的分隔符,可以使用sep参数来指定分隔符。 import pandas as pd # 使用分号作为分隔符读取CSV数据 df = pd.read_csv('data_semicolon.csv', sep=';') 跳过行和指定列 ...
最终,我想为每个 CSV 提取这些列下的所有行,并将它们附加到仅包含这两列的数据框中。我曾尝试先使用一个 CSV 执行此操作,但无法使其工作。这是我尝试过的:import pandas as pdfrom io import StringIOdf = pd.read_csv("test.csv")dfout = pd.DataFrame(columns=['Programme', 'Recommends'])for file ...
一.pd.read_csv() 1.filepath_or_buffer:(这是唯一一个必须有的参数,其它都是按需求选用的) 文件所在处的路径 2.sep: 指定分隔符,默认为逗号',' 3.delimiter: str, default None 定界符,备选分隔符(如果指定该参数,则sep参数失效) 4.header:int or list of ints, default ‘infer’ ...